Yonas Yanfa <yonas@fizk.net> has reassigned Bugzilla Automation <bugzilla@FreeBSD.org>'s request for maintainer-feedback to x11@FreeBSD.org: Bug 210542: x11/xorg: Better documentation regarding 3D acceleration https://bugs.freebsd.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=210542 --- Description --- There are two issues: 1. It's not very obvious that users need to add themselves to the "video" group for 3D acceleration to work. 2. The documentation states that users can add themselves to either the "video" or "wheel" group. In my case, I was already part of the wheel group, and I needed to specifically add myself to the video group to enable 3D acceleration (i915 on FreeBSD-11 CURRENT). If it's not a bug that users need to specifically be part of the video group, then I think we need to enable 3D acceleration for anyone in the wheel group as well.
